Liyana Kayali

 

 

Biography 

Liyana is an interdisciplinary scholar of the Middle East, with a particular interest in Palestine. She has previously held appointments as lecturer at the Australian National University, research fellow at the University of Sussex, postdoctoral research fellow at the University of Sydney, and research associate at the Centre for Gender Studies at the School of Oriental and African Studies (SOAS) at the University of London. In 2022 she was awarded the Exiting Violence Fellowship by Columbia Global Centers. Liyana’s research interests encompass gender, popular resistance, restorative justice, and anti-racism.
